
Excel控件为什么用不了怎么办
Excel控件无法使用可能是由于以下几个原因:控件未启用、宏安全设置过高、ActiveX控件未注册、Excel版本兼容性问题、文件受损。其中,控件未启用是最常见的问题之一。在Excel中,如果开发者选项未启用,控件将无法正常使用。启用控件的方法是:点击“文件”,选择“选项”,然后在“自定义功能区”中勾选“开发工具”。接下来,用户可以在“开发工具”选项卡下找到控件,并将其添加到工作表中。
一、控件未启用
在Excel中,控件是一种强大的工具,可以帮助用户创建交互式的工作表。然而,如果控件未启用,用户将无法使用这些功能。以下是启用控件的详细步骤:
-
启用开发者选项:首先,用户需要确保开发者选项已启用。点击“文件”菜单,然后选择“选项”。在弹出的对话框中,选择“自定义功能区”,然后在右侧的列表中勾选“开发工具”。点击“确定”以保存更改。
-
添加控件:启用开发者选项后,用户可以在“开发工具”选项卡下找到各种控件。选择所需的控件并将其添加到工作表中。例如,用户可以选择“按钮”控件,并将其拖放到工作表中的适当位置。
二、宏安全设置过高
Excel中的宏是用来自动化任务的脚本,但由于宏可能包含恶意代码,因此Excel提供了安全设置来保护用户。如果宏安全设置过高,控件可能无法正常工作。以下是调整宏安全设置的方法:
-
打开宏设置:点击“文件”菜单,然后选择“选项”。在弹出的对话框中,选择“信任中心”,然后点击“信任中心设置”。
-
调整宏设置:在“信任中心”设置对话框中,选择“宏设置”。用户可以选择“启用所有宏(不推荐,可能会运行潜在危险代码)”以确保所有宏都能运行。请注意,这可能会降低Excel的安全性,因此用户应谨慎使用。
-
信任受信任的位置:为了进一步确保控件能够正常工作,用户可以在“受信任的位置”中添加工作簿所在的文件夹。这样,Excel将自动信任该文件夹中的所有文件。
三、ActiveX控件未注册
ActiveX控件是用于增强Excel功能的组件,但如果这些控件未正确注册,用户将无法使用它们。以下是注册ActiveX控件的方法:
-
打开命令提示符:在Windows搜索栏中输入“cmd”,然后右键点击“命令提示符”,选择“以管理员身份运行”。
-
注册控件:在命令提示符中,输入以下命令以注册ActiveX控件:
regsvr32 /s 控件路径例如,如果控件位于C:WindowsSystem32目录中,命令将类似于:
regsvr32 /s C:WindowsSystem32控件名称.ocx -
重启Excel:注册控件后,重启Excel以确保更改生效。
四、Excel版本兼容性问题
不同版本的Excel可能存在兼容性问题,导致控件无法正常使用。以下是解决兼容性问题的方法:
-
检查Excel版本:首先,用户需要确认使用的Excel版本。点击“文件”菜单,然后选择“账户”以查看版本信息。
-
更新Excel:确保Excel已更新到最新版本。点击“文件”菜单,然后选择“账户”。在“产品信息”部分,点击“更新选项”,选择“立即更新”以检查并安装最新更新。
-
兼容模式:如果用户使用的是较新的Excel版本,但工作簿是使用较旧版本创建的,可能会导致兼容性问题。在这种情况下,用户可以尝试将工作簿保存为最新版本的Excel格式。点击“文件”菜单,然后选择“另存为”,在文件类型下拉列表中选择最新的Excel格式(例如,.xlsx)。
五、文件受损
有时候,控件无法使用可能是由于工作簿文件受损。以下是修复受损文件的方法:
-
打开Excel并尝试修复文件:点击“文件”菜单,然后选择“打开”。在打开对话框中,选择受损的工作簿文件,然后点击“打开和修复”。
-
选择修复选项:在弹出的对话框中,选择“修复”以尽量恢复文件。如果修复失败,可以尝试选择“提取数据”以提取文件中的数据。
-
创建新文件:如果修复受损文件的方法无法解决问题,用户可以尝试将数据复制到一个新的Excel文件中。这样可以避免由于文件受损导致的控件问题。
六、使用正确的Excel版本
不同的Excel版本在功能和控件支持上可能有所不同。有些控件可能在较旧版本中无法正常工作。以下是确保使用正确Excel版本的方法:
-
确认Excel版本:首先,用户需要确认自己使用的Excel版本。点击“文件”菜单,然后选择“账户”以查看版本信息。
-
升级到最新版本:如果用户使用的是较旧的Excel版本,建议升级到最新版本。点击“文件”菜单,然后选择“账户”。在“产品信息”部分,点击“更新选项”,选择“立即更新”以检查并安装最新更新。
-
检查控件兼容性:在升级Excel版本后,用户可以检查所需控件的兼容性。大多数现代控件在最新版本的Excel中都能正常工作。
七、确保文件未受保护
受保护的工作簿可能会限制控件的使用。以下是解除工作簿保护的方法:
-
解除工作簿保护:打开受保护的工作簿,点击“审阅”选项卡,然后选择“解除工作簿保护”。如果工作簿受到密码保护,用户需要输入密码才能解除保护。
-
解除工作表保护:在一些情况下,单个工作表也可能受到保护。用户可以点击“审阅”选项卡,然后选择“解除工作表保护”。
-
保存更改:解除保护后,用户可以尝试添加和使用控件。确保保存更改以避免再次受到保护。
八、检查VBA代码
有时候,控件无法使用可能是由于VBA代码中的错误。以下是检查和修复VBA代码的方法:
-
打开VBA编辑器:按下“Alt + F11”键打开VBA编辑器。
-
检查代码:在VBA编辑器中,检查与控件相关的代码。确保代码中没有语法错误或逻辑错误。用户可以使用“调试”菜单中的“编译”选项来检查代码中的错误。
-
修复代码:如果发现代码中的错误,用户可以根据错误提示进行修复。修复完成后,保存更改并关闭VBA编辑器。
-
测试控件:回到Excel工作表,测试控件是否能够正常使用。
九、检查系统权限
在某些情况下,系统权限不足也可能导致控件无法使用。以下是检查和调整系统权限的方法:
-
检查用户权限:确保用户具有足够的系统权限来运行Excel和使用控件。用户可以与系统管理员联系,确认自己的账户是否具有管理员权限。
-
运行Excel为管理员:右键点击Excel图标,选择“以管理员身份运行”。这样可以确保Excel拥有足够的权限来使用控件。
-
调整文件权限:确保工作簿文件所在的文件夹具有正确的权限设置。右键点击文件夹,选择“属性”,然后在“安全”选项卡中检查和调整权限设置。
十、检查加载项冲突
加载项冲突也可能导致控件无法使用。以下是检查和禁用加载项的方法:
-
打开加载项管理器:点击“文件”菜单,然后选择“选项”。在弹出的对话框中,选择“加载项”。
-
禁用加载项:在“加载项”选项卡中,选择“COM加载项”或“Excel加载项”,然后点击“转到”。在加载项列表中,取消勾选所有加载项,然后点击“确定”。
-
重启Excel:禁用加载项后,重启Excel并检查控件是否能够正常使用。如果问题解决,用户可以逐个启用加载项以确定哪个加载项导致了冲突。
十一、使用正确的控件类型
不同类型的控件在Excel中有不同的使用方法。以下是选择和使用正确控件类型的方法:
-
ActiveX控件:ActiveX控件功能强大,但在某些环境中可能会受到限制。用户可以在“开发工具”选项卡下找到ActiveX控件,并将其添加到工作表中。
-
表单控件:表单控件更简单,兼容性更好。用户可以在“开发工具”选项卡下找到表单控件,并将其添加到工作表中。
-
选择适当的控件:根据具体需求选择适当的控件类型。例如,如果需要创建一个简单的按钮来触发宏,表单控件可能是更好的选择。如果需要创建复杂的用户界面,ActiveX控件可能更合适。
十二、检查Excel设置
某些Excel设置可能会影响控件的使用。以下是检查和调整Excel设置的方法:
-
检查Excel选项:点击“文件”菜单,然后选择“选项”。在弹出的对话框中,检查各个选项卡中的设置,确保没有选项会限制控件的使用。
-
调整高级设置:在“选项”对话框中,选择“高级”选项卡。在“显示选项”部分,确保“显示所有窗口内容”已勾选。这将确保控件在工作表中正确显示。
-
重置Excel设置:如果不确定哪些设置可能导致问题,用户可以尝试重置Excel设置。点击“文件”菜单,然后选择“选项”。在“选项”对话框中,选择“自定义功能区”,然后点击“重置”。这将恢复Excel的默认设置。
十三、检查控件属性
控件的属性设置不正确也可能导致其无法正常使用。以下是检查和调整控件属性的方法:
-
选择控件:在工作表中,右键点击控件,然后选择“属性”。
-
检查属性设置:在“属性”窗口中,检查控件的各个属性。确保所有属性设置正确,例如“Enabled”属性应设置为True以确保控件可用。
-
调整属性:如果发现属性设置不正确,用户可以根据需要进行调整。调整完成后,保存更改并关闭“属性”窗口。
十四、检查系统更新
系统更新可能会影响Excel的功能。以下是检查和安装系统更新的方法:
-
检查系统更新:打开“设置”应用,选择“更新和安全”,然后点击“检查更新”。确保系统已安装所有最新的更新。
-
安装更新:如果有可用的更新,用户可以点击“下载并安装”以安装更新。安装完成后,重启计算机以确保更新生效。
-
检查Excel功能:系统更新完成后,打开Excel并检查控件是否能够正常使用。
十五、联系技术支持
如果尝试了上述所有方法后,控件仍然无法使用,用户可以联系技术支持获取帮助。以下是联系技术支持的方法:
-
访问Microsoft支持网站:用户可以访问Microsoft支持网站(support.microsoft.com),搜索相关问题的解决方案。
-
联系技术支持:如果在支持网站上无法找到解决方案,用户可以联系Microsoft技术支持。提供详细的错误信息和尝试过的解决方案,以便技术支持人员更好地帮助解决问题。
-
社区支持:用户还可以在Excel社区论坛(answers.microsoft.com)上发布问题,寻求其他用户的帮助和建议。
十六、总结
Excel控件无法使用可能是由于多种原因,包括控件未启用、宏安全设置过高、ActiveX控件未注册、Excel版本兼容性问题、文件受损等。通过逐步检查和调整这些因素,用户可以解决大多数控件问题。确保使用正确的Excel版本、适当的控件类型,并检查系统权限和加载项冲突等问题,可以帮助用户在Excel中更好地使用控件。如果问题仍然无法解决,用户可以联系技术支持获取帮助。
相关问答FAQs:
1. 为什么我的Excel控件不能正常使用?
Excel控件无法正常使用可能是由于以下原因导致的:浏览器不兼容、插件未正确安装、Excel控件被阻止或禁用等。
2. 怎么解决Excel控件无法使用的问题?
首先,您可以尝试使用其他浏览器,比如Google Chrome或Mozilla Firefox,来确认是否是浏览器兼容性问题。其次,确保已正确安装了Excel插件,可以尝试重新安装或更新插件。还可以检查浏览器的安全设置,确保Excel控件未被阻止或禁用。如果问题仍然存在,您可以尝试更新浏览器或操作系统,或者联系技术支持获取进一步的帮助。
3. 如何避免Excel控件无法使用的问题?
为了避免Excel控件无法使用的问题,您可以按照以下步骤进行操作:确保使用最新版本的浏览器和插件,定期检查和更新。在安装插件时,务必按照正确的步骤进行操作,并确保插件已成功安装。在使用Excel控件之前,先检查浏览器的安全设置,并确保Excel控件未被阻止或禁用。如果遇到问题,及时与技术支持联系,以获取及时帮助和解决方案。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/3966040